Who Is Pratt & Miller Engineering and What Do They Do?
Known for being a leading force in professional motorsports, the team at Pratt & Miller has evolved into a world-class engineering company renowned for using advanced technology, full-service engineering, and low-volume manufacturing solutions. With near to 300 employees, Pratt & Miller serves a global customer base and has quickly become a respected leader in the automotive, commercial, military, and aerospace industries.
Best known for winning the famed "24 Hours of Le Mans" eight times is evidence of the dedication that Pratt & Miller has towards exceeding their customer's expectations.

    Abstract: A truck scale fraud occurred in Pratt Recycling recently. There was collusion between the scale operator and several peddlers. The operator overstated the net weight information on the weight tickets and would create fictitious weight tickets when no weighing had taken place. Pratt started to require more documentation from peddlers and updated an automated scale system. Moreover, Pratt strengthened its monitoring process and adopted other internal control methods.…

    Briggs and Stratton is an American industrial company that primarily is involved in engineering, developing, and manufacturing internal combustion gas engines for small power machines. The company was started in 1908 and they are the world’s leading producer in small engines and specialize in products such as: generators, pressure washers, snow blowers, air compressors, and lawnmower engines. The Briggs and Stratton plant in Auburn has been in service since August of 1995. The company has been a top 5 employer in the area since it has opened and has been actively involved in community activities such as Habitat for Humanity, United Way, and Rebuilding Together; they have also been a long-running sponsor of the Fourth of July fireworks for the City of Auburn.
